About this Event
For participants who have attended a past seasonal QBG watercolor workshop or are already familiar with the basics of the watercolor medium, join artist Chemin Hsiao to experience the playful side of watercolor painting: to construct full arrangements of composition on paper by utilizing the brushwork of watercolor, and the seasonal botanical references at Queens Botanical Garden.
All materials provided. Recommended for adults and children ages 10+ (accompanied by participating adult).

$35 Non-Member / $30 Member* (includes garden admission) Registration required; walk-ins welcome upon availability

Meeting Location: Visitor & Administration Building

About Queens Botanical Garden

QBG is an urban oasis where people, plants and cultures are celebrated through inspiring gardens, innovative educational programs and real-world applications of environmental stewardship. QBG is located on property owned by the City of New York, and its operation is made possible in part by public funds provided through the New York City Department of Cultural Affairs, Queens Borough President, the New York City Council, State elected officials, the New York State Department of Parks, Recreation and Historic Preservation, along with corporate, foundation, and individual supporters.
